Joint Director

Arindam Das

Arindam is the Joint Director of the Foundation. He is pursuing Ph.D. in Economics from Birla Institute of Technology and Science (BITS)-Pilani, Hyderabad. Arindam leads the Project on Agrarian Relations in India (PARI). He has worked at the Foundation from 2011 and has in-depth knowledge about various data management and analysis techniques. His research interests include rural wage rates and its determinants, rural employment, and Economics of farming. He has hands-on expertise in the use of R software for social science research.
